Genk is favored to secure a comfortable home victory over Lech Poznan on August 28, 2025, backed by recent performances and previous head-to-head results. They are likely to dominate the match with aggressive attacking play, possibly securing a large margin.
Historically, Genk has the upper hand against Lech Poznan, winning all recent encounters including a convincing 5-1 victory last season.
Both teams have some injury concerns, but key players like Noah Adedeji-Sternberg for Genk and B. Mrozek for Lech Poznan are expected to feature despite minor issues.
Genk is likely to field a 4-4-2 formation, emphasizing offensive pressure, while Lech Poznan may set up in a 4-2-3-1, adopting a more balanced approach possibly focusing on counter-attacks.
Genk is in excellent form with consistent wins, especially at home, whereas Lech Poznan has been underperforming away from their stadium.
